QUIC: additional limit for probing packets.
RFC 9000, 9.3. Responding to Connection Migration:
An endpoint only changes the address to which it sends packets in
response to the highest-numbered non-probing packet.
The patch extends this requirement to probing packets. Although it may
seem excessive, it helps with mitigation of reply attacks (when an off-path
attacker has copied packet with PATH_CHALLENGE and uses different
addresses to exhaust available connection ids).
